Ponticelli Frères, which is an industrial group with international activities providing technical  to companies in the oil and gas industry, is looking for a QAQC Manager, based in its subsidiary in Nigeria.

 

The selected applicant will have to carry out the following activities:

 

QAQC Activity

  • Manage and oversee project quality to ensure compliance to codes, standards, regulations, equipment specific specifications, and QMS requirements
  • Advancing quality achievement and performance improvement throughout the organization
  • Managing the development and implementation of the QMS for planning, fabrication, inspection, documentation, and operations activities including:
  1. Planning duties within the QA/QC staff and related work schedules;
  2. Establishing service standards for end users (i.e., internal department or external customer)
  3. Identifying and developing QA/QC personnel certification requirements and continuing education/training needs
  4. Providing leadership, mentorship, and direction of all QA/QC personnel.
  • Taking full responsibility for hold-point releases once all QMS functions have been completed and the equipment is ready to go into the next work stage
  • Developing and implementing risk-based inspection (RBI) activities and processes
  • Managing plant integrity through a failure analysis reporting system and following up on recommendations
  • Oversee supervision of all visual inspections and NDE, including 3rd party subcontractors
  • Managing inspection, NDE, and testing plans for new construction, repair work, and alterations
  • Identify and develop solutions to correct inspection function deficiencies
  • Manage construction processes, plant equipment, inspection and NDE personnel certification and QMS internal audits.

 

Welding activity

  • Management of all welding procedures and qualifications and testing
  • Analyse welding requirements for specific projects ensuring the any already approved in house procedures are acceptable and generate new procedures specific to project requirements and needs
  • Responsibility for the coordination of multiple projects and managing external test laboratories and Classification societies and Notified bodies with regard to welding procedures their approvals and testing
  • Provide technical support with industry standards and specifications such as ASME Boiler and Pressure Vessel Code, AWS, BS EN, plus any other relevant standards which may be required
  • Management and control of all materials and consumables for welder testing and procedures
  • Coordinate failure analyses and root cause analysis on welding related issues if required
  • Set up and control and maintenance of a welder data base.
